Articles 68 and 69 of the Mozambique hunting regulations seem to cover this issue.

In reply to:


SECTION VI
Hunting for defence of people and goods

ARTICLE 68

Requirements

1) The following constitute the requirements for the exercise of hunting in defence of people
and goods

a) The existence of an actual or imminent attack by wild animals on persons or goods
b) The impossibility of driving away one or more animals which are persecuting or
attacking people or goods
An imminent attack is considered to be when one or more wild animals are heading for
or have entered property or dwelling areas with strong indications that they may attack
the people and goods existing there

2) For the effect of No. 1 the impossibility to drive away animals is considered to exist when
dealing with dangerous animals, or others which are not dangerous when they will not
move even despite the employment of methods considered to be the norm for driving away
that particular species

3) Goods is taken to mean human life, agriculture, domestic animals, dwellings, vehicles and
other items of economic value or social relevance

4) The hunting referred to in this article is not subject to closed seasons nor to the limitations
and restrictions defined for hunting activities

ARTICLE 69

Competent entities

1) Those competent to carry out the type of hunting referred to above in defence of people and
goods are specialised brigades which should comprise inspectors or other functionaries
from that sector (SPFFB), community agents assisting the inspectors, professional hunters
and community hunters

2) In terms of the previous number those assisting the inspectors, the professional hunters, and
community hunters may, together with the SPFFB request that they are authorised to hunt in defence of people and goods




So Article 68 seems to state what a PAC animal is, and Article 69 seems to state who can hunt the animal. Under Article 69, it states that professional hunters may engage in that hunting, and Article 69 paragraph 2) seems to state that others may assist the PHs in that endeavor.

Freischutz, I am not trying to argue with you. However, the text of the regulations seems to provide an avenue for PAC hunts to occur. Is this a case of vague regulations which the Moz game department is attempting to clear up through the notice that Nitrox posted?
